Located only 25 miles from New York’s mid-town Manhattan in one of the most charming Hudson River villages in the metropolitan area, the Edward Hopper House Museum & Study Center is the historic family home where America’s most renowned artist was born and spent the first 26 years of his life. It highlights early Hopper works and the opportunity for visitors to experience the surrounding environment that inspired him and his choices of light, color, and subject matter that imbues his later work. Truly a unique experience! The house (built in 1858, with an 1882 addition) is registered on the National Register of Historic Places and the museum is a member of the Historic Artists Homes & Studios, a prestigious alliance run by the National Trust of Historic Preservation.

FIRST STUDIO; galleries- former parlors; views of the river form house and porch .

Edward Hopper House Museum & Study Center
Explore the historic house where Edward Hopper was born and raised, enjoy rotating displays of Hopper's early work and family artifacts along with exhibitions by well-known artists inspired by Hopper's legacy; Explore the orientation film and historic maps of "Hopper's Nyack" where he lived until 1908, when at age 26 he relocated to New York City.

A terrific museum visit that helped me develop a much more thorough and nuanced appreciation of Hopper -- I say that as someone already pretty well-versed in 20th century art. Everything is well-curated and informative. My children were surprisingly well-behaved as well -- the museum does a great job of trying to engage younger visitors. While it's a small museum, it's very easy to linger for a good while. Standouts include the very accomplished artwork Hopper's mother did as an eight-year-old, Hopper's childhood sketch of a boy along the river on the back of his elementary school report card, and many ofd the early sketches that formed the basis of later famous paintings. Hopper's bedroom with the view of the Hudson and the distinctive light was very engaging.
